    Description

    The Tramex MEX5 Moisture Encounter is a digital, dual-depth moisture and humidity meter designed for building inspection, moisture survey and restoration professionals. It features non-destructive measurement capabilities for moisture content in wood, drywall and a variety of building materials, and includes a built-in hygrometer and infrared surface thermometer. Optional plug-in pin-type probes and in-situ RH (relative humidity) probes expand its functionality for pin measurements, equilibrium RH testing and ambient environment monitoring.

    Key features:

    • Dual-depth non-destructive measurement: shallow to approximately ⅜″ (9 mm) and deep to approximately 1¼″ (30 mm) for surface and core moisture comparison.
    • Built-in hygrometer and infrared surface thermometer enabling ambient RH, temperature, dew point, humidity ratio (g/kg) and surface temperature readings.
    • Optional plug-in pin probes and in-situ RH probes for extended use such as wood flooring, drywall, WME testing and ASTM F2170–type relative humidity tests.
    • Bluetooth connectivity to the Tramex Meters App for moisture mapping, Geo-tagging, report generation and documentation.

    How To

    • Clean the surface of the material being tested and ensure the meter electrodes are free of debris.
    • Power on the MEX5, select the desired mode (non-destructive, pin probe, or RH probe) depending on the material and measurement type.
    • For non-destructive mode, press the meter firmly onto the surface and read the moisture value; for pin probe mode insert the pins properly and read the moisture content.
    • Use the built-in hygrometer or connect an in-situ RH probe to measure ambient or embedded humidity conditions and surface temperature as needed.
    • Connect the meter via Bluetooth to the Tramex Meters App, log or map your readings, Geo-tag locations and generate reports for documentation.
